ORDER

1. Affidavit of service filed in Court today is taken on record. 2. The instant writ petition has been filed, inter alia, challenging the refusal on the part of the appellate authority to condone the delay in maintaining the appeal under Section 107 of the West Bengal Goods and Services Tax Act, 2017 (hereinafter referred to as the “said Act”) by its order dated 13th March, 2024. 3. It is the petitioner’s case that being aggrieved with the determination made under Section 73 of the said Act dated 2nd May, 2023, the petitioner had filed an appeal under Section 107 of the said Act. Since, the appeal was filed beyond the period of limitation, the same was accompanied by an application under Section 5 of the Limitation Act, 1963. The appellate authority, however, appears to have rejected the said application for condoning the delay by its order dated 13th March, 2024 and had consequentially rejected the appeal without entertaining the same. 4.
